  • Patent number: 4485257
    Abstract: The present invention is to provide the process for preparing racemized cyclopropanecarboxylic acids or their acid anhydrides from the corresponding optically active, particularly levo-rotatory, cyclopropanecarboxylic acid anhydrides. The racemization is effected by the treatment of the optically active acid anhydride with a Lewis acid. Thus, the present racemization process enables more efficient commercial production of dextro-rotatory cyclopropanecarboxylic acids, which are the more effective acid component of pyrethroidal insecticides, when combined with an optical resolution process.

  • Patent number: 4479005
    Abstract: A process has been discovered for selective preparation of isomers and enantiomers of 2,2-dimethyl-3-(2,2-dihalovinyl)cyclopropane carboxylic acids. In this process an adduct of an alkyl 3,3-dimethyl-4-pentenoate and a substituted 2-oxazolidone is reacted with a substituted dihalomethane compound. The resulting compound is cyclized, dehydrohalogenated and hydrolyzed to yield the desired product. These cyclopropane carboxylic acids are useful precursors for pyrethroid insecticides.

  • Patent number: 4473703
    Abstract: A process for isomerization of cis-chrysanthemate esters by contacting a chrysanthemate ester containing a cis-chrysanthemate ester with a Lewis acid, to transform the cis-chrysanthemate ester into trans-chrysanthemate ester through epimerization at C.sub.3 -position. The starting cis-chrysanthemate ester may be of any optical isomer ratio form (+)-form to (-)-form, including racemic form. Accordingly the process is effectively employable for the preparation of a (+)-trans-chrysanthemate ester from the (+)-cis-chrysanthemate ester. Combinations of the process with optical resolution would make the commercial production of (+)-trans-chrysanthemic acid more effective, the latter being an important acid component of pyrethroidal insecticides.

  • Patent number: 4458090
    Abstract: Novel .gamma.-lactone derivatives are provided. These lactone derivatives, when reacted with hydrogen halide in alcohol, yield .gamma.-halogeno-.delta.-unsaturated carboxylic acid esters. This ring-opening process is useful for the purpose of increasing the yield of pyrethrin analogs which are of value as insecticides and agricultural chemicals. Thus, the .gamma.-lactone derivatives by-produced in the production process for dihalogenovinyl chrysanthemumates are caused to undergo ring-opening reaction to yield the corresponding .gamma.-halogeno-.delta.-unsaturated carboxylic acid esters which are important intermediates for said pyrethrin analogs.

  • Patent number: 4419524
    Abstract: The invention relates to a new process for the preparation of cyclopropanecarboxylic acids of the formula (I) ##STR1## wherein X and Y independently stand for halogen, by the alkaline hydrolysis of the corresponding alkyl esters having 1 to 6 carbon atoms in the alkyl moiety, in or without a water-miscible organic solvent, in the presence of a phase transfer catalyst. The hydrolysis is carried out with a 2 to 50% by weight aqueous alkali hydroxide solution. If desired, under suitable conditions the cis/trans ratio of the original ester can be altered in the end products. The cyclopropanecarboxylic acids of the formula (I) are obtained in a high purity and are useful intermediates of insecticidally active pyrethroids.
